1/18, 1/12 something like that. I have scratchbuilt a 1/12 Guzzi 500cc V8 engine in white metal and would like to recreate the stillborn Bill Lomas Cooper-Guzzi of 1958. Redoing it smaller should be do-able but 1/18 would be the smallest feasible (of what is a small engine 1:1). I actually built jigs and made up a frame of a MK X Cooper; this included the front leaf springs - which were too effective in that it would have required incredible strength in the uprights to hold them. I got bored making all the ancillary stuff hence the question.
